DW Akademie in Moldova is seeking trainers for a series of interactive workshops focused on AI applications in journalism.

The rapid advancement of generative artificial intelligence (AI) presents both opportunities and challenges for the global information ecosystem. Newsrooms face a growing digital divide, with some able to invest in new technologies while others fall behind. The proliferation of disinformation, ethical concerns around automation, and potential algorithmic biases are leading to a decline in public trust in journalism.

To address these challenges, DW Akademie in Moldova is supporting its partner, the Moldova School of Journalism, in developing a series of interactive workshops focused on AI applications in journalism. These workshops will be part of two key events:

“Podcast Fest” – a one-day networking event for Moldova’s podcasting community”Shape the Future of Journalism: Using AI Tools to Your Advantage” – a three-day event aimed at equipping media professionals with practical AI skills.

The overarching objective of the project (2023-2025) is to bolster the Media and Journalism Education in Moldova by developing the Moldova School of Journalism to become an innovation center for quality journalism and thereby strengthen the quality of reporting by independent media professionals.

This will be achieved through the qualification of local trainers, the development of curricula tailored to specific needs, and the delivery of high-quality journalism education programs addressing the most pressing issues facing the media community.
